The intern will join the Methods team of the Industrial Process Engineering department in Moirans, attached to the FLX Industrial Competence Center of Thales AVS France. The team, composed of about ten employees, manages the industrial tool: development and industrialization of processes, design of tools and workstations, manufacturing of prototypes, creation and maintenance of production files, optimization of existing processes, and second-level technical support.
The intern will support the Methods teams and the Manufacturing Process Manager in deploying the ISO 9100 methodology related to special processes on the site, to contribute to:
- Identifying and listing all special processes in collaboration with business experts and production teams
- Centralizing and organizing technical documentation related to special processes to ensure its conformity and accessibility
- Participating in the planning, preparation, and execution of tests associated with special processes in interaction with operators and stakeholders
- Implementing periodic monitoring of processes by developing indicators and maintaining monitoring files and control reports
- Supporting the team in improving existing processes via analyses, proposals for corrective actions, and feedback
